An ode to a mountain—lovingly researched and gorgeously captured for all the world to see

Coming from the acclaimed writer of Signal and Kingdom, expect a non-linear thriller with preternatural elements featuring a solid cast of actors. At its core, this is simply a love story about Mount Jiri and the people who risk their lives to protect it.

Each episode provides glimpses of the various challenges rangers have to face in the course of their duties. There are short, funny anecdotes. And then there are the tragic, haunting ones. Bits of Korea's actual history are woven into the story, with sprinkles of wildlife trivia as well. There is an over-arching mystery following our lead characters that provides us viewers with that sense of urgency to understand what has happened and how to rectify the situation. I also like the very subtle, barely-there, thread of romance.

On the downside, the OST so far has been forgettable and there are some who have been complaining about the CGI.

But for someone who studied at the foot of a mountain reserve and volunteered for ecological activities hosted there, Jirisan is my kind of watch. Mysteries like this usually have a low rewatch value once you've figured out who's who at the end of the series. I think Jirisan will still be a compelling rewatch for me because of its gorgeous backdrop. Right now, it makes me want to go hiking again and join the rangers in their mission.

Solid as a rock.

In short, Jirisan is a solid drama. The creators set a tone and pace in the first episode, which they managed to keep until the end. At no point did I feel the drama lost its track or got boring, it has solid pace, a solid storyline and solid characters.

Even though it's neither as enthralling as the premise may sound nor as sparkly as the A-list cast portraying the characters, it does have something that make it stand out from other k-dramas, maybe it's the unique setting or the realistic tone, cannot point it out.

Jirisan has a linear story telling (despite its constant time jumping, which some may find confusing), as in there is progress in the story with each episode giving away clues and bringing you one step closer to the truth about the ongoing crime-mystery surrounding the mountain. The thing about that mystery-thriller genre however is that even though it's the theme of the drama it's not its focus. I'm sure many might have felt that this show seems more like some "Mountain Playlist" in line with Hospital Playlist or Prison Playbook, except for less humor and more realness. I actually enjoyed the mix of mystic thriller and daily log of rangers' tasks and duties and also the insight into the lives of the villagers, people visiting the mountain and for sure enjoyed the beautiful backdrop of Mount Jiri.

The seasoned actors delivered. There is nothing more to add, as there was no one in particular who stood out from the rest. I think that's mainly because all characters seemed "pretty normal" as if they were real people with real stories, no stereotypes, no exaggeratations, no overly dramatic fl, no unbearably badass ml - just well written characters mirroring real people. It was nice to see Jun Ji Hyun again after her long break and Ju Ji Hoon as Hyun-Joo with his charmingly calm demeanor.

What I enjoyed most about this drama is that every episode felt like one chapter from an encyclopedia on Jirisan National Parks, showcasing not only the beauty of the mountain but also nature's unpredictable cruelty. Also, some scenes were surprisingly touching and emotional, I sometimes found myself struggling with holding back the tears.
The camaraderie shared by the rangers is another strength of the show; again, it was neither over the top nor too bland, just perfectly balanced and fun to watch.

Some Minor flaws, - little spoiler - there are a lot of deaths in the show and some felt really unnecessary and were hardly dealt with. Also I would have loved to see more interaction between the main characters, especially in the last episodes, but that is just my preference.

The main lesson I take from the show is how tough physically demanding jobs are, which makes me appreciate fireworkers, police officers and rangers among others even more. This show is a song of praise to those heroes.

Beautiful nature...but could've been more than that...

I basically like that with Jirisan there's a drama where actually the main star is nature itself with all it's beauty and dangers, which are definitely explored here beside the supernatural induced crime story. The shooting of the nature aspect was flawless in my opinion. I guess one can hardly find dramas similar in that aspect (proove me wrong). For me it would even work as a South Korea travel advertisement, knowing that not all scenes are actually from Jirisan area.

On the other hand, the expectations one could have from knowing the screenwriter and director are some of the industries top people in the last years were kind of disappointed. For the screenwriting I could sense some similar strategy like done in Signal, but nowhere close living up to that level of tension done back then. Also the direction was confusing at points and often let me think, why did he choose to do it like that, while I was okay with the jumps in time. A similar aspect used in Signal.

For the acting I generally liked the whole cast, especially the ML Joo Ji Hoon with his friendly and nice attitude and the rookie ranger Go Min Si. Regarding Jun Ji Hyun I thought in this particular drama she couldn't really shine, may be also due to the role itself, as of course it's not her usual one. She couldn't carry the show sometimes and her expressions in general felt a bit pale...may be another actress could've been better. It seemed somehow they tried to make sure all positions are filled with well-established stars, not to take any risk.

The crime story was okay, had some nice twists and always tried to connect to the aspect of the rangers and the mountain. At the end kind of predictable. I would have wished for some romance, so it's just subtle, but knowing the author it couldn't be expected easily...

Though overall I admit it's complaining at a high level and I recommend the show especially to everybody wanting to look at an entire drama set in a nature environment. Somehow it just couldn't live up to the hype. So some good opportunities wasted here for such a setting...may be next time...
